Definition and characteristics of combination skin. Common issues faced by those with combination skin.Combination skin can feel like a confusing puzzle. It mixes oily and dry areas on your face. The T-zone, which includes your forehead, nose, and chin, may shine like a disco ball, while the cheeks can feel as dry as the Sahara. This variety leads to common issues like breakouts in the oily spots and dryness in other areas. Keeping your skin balanced can feel like hosting a party where some guests love to dance, and others just want to sit and sip tea!
Characteristics | Common Issues |
---|---|
Shiny T-zone | Breakouts |
Dry cheeks | Flaky skin |
Uneven texture | Pore size variation |

Moisturizing: Hydration Without Oily Residue
Types of moisturizers best suited for combination skin. Tips for layering products effectively.Finding the right moisturizer can be tricky for combination skin. You need something that hydrates without making your skin oily. Look for these types:
- Gel-based moisturizers: Light and absorb quickly.
- Oil-free lotions: Provide moisture without extra oil.
- Water-based creams: Great for hydration without heaviness.
Layering products is key. Start with a serum, then use your moisturizer. This way, you lock in hydration. Remember to apply in gentle, circular motions for best results!
What type of moisturizer is best for combination skin?
The best moisturizers for combination skin are lightweight, oil-free, and hydrating. Look for labels that say “non-comedogenic,” which means they won’t clog pores.
Exfoliation: Maintaining Skin Balance
Recommended exfoliants for combination skin. Frequency of exfoliation based on skin type.Exfoliating is like giving your skin a fresh start! For combination skin, look for exfoliants like gentle scrubs or mild chemical peels. Products with salicylic acid and lactic acid are great choices. Aim to exfoliate two to three times a week. Too much scrubbing can irritate your skin, making it angrier than a cat in a bath! Below is a handy table to guide your exfoliation routine:
Skin Type | Exfoliation Frequency |
---|---|
Normal | 1-2 times a week |
Combination | 2-3 times a week |
Oily | 3-4 times a week |
Dry | Once a week |

FAQs about Combination Skin Care Routines
Common questions and expert answers regarding combination skin. Debunking myths related to skincare for this skin type.Many people have questions about how to care for combination skin. Here are some common ones:
What is combination skin?
Combination skin has both oily and dry areas. Often, the forehead, nose, and chin, known as the “T-zone,” are oily. The cheeks can be dry. Balancing care for both areas is key!
Can I use any products?
No, choose products wisely! Look for gentle moisturizers and cleansers. Avoid harsh ingredients that can upset the balance.
Is it true that oily skin doesn’t need moisturizer?
False! All skin types, including oily, need moisturizer. It keeps skin healthy and prevents over-drying.
How often should I wash my face?
Wash your face twice daily. This helps remove dirt and oil without drying out your skin.
